Yemen's marches reiterate Gaza solidarity, animosity for US-'Israel'

Yemen assures that the Yemeni people will not allow the United States or "Israel" to determine which nations are hostile, and which are not.

Million-man marches swept Yemen across over 500 central and regional gathering points across 14 governorates, massively in Sanaa's al-Sabeen Square, in a consistent show of solidarity with the Palestinian people and their Resistance, organized under the banner of "Unwavering, Relentless, and Resolute Solidarity with Gaza."

A statement issued by the million-man march organizers confirmed, first and foremost, "Yemen's utmost animosity towards the Zionists," as well as its condemnations of their crimes in Gaza, the desecration of Gaza's sacred assets, and the burning of the Holy Quran. 

The statement further assured that the Yemeni people would not allow the United States or "Israel" to determine which nations are hostile, and which are not.

Addressing US President-elect Donald Trump and responding to his latest threat to the Palestinian Resistance, the statement said, "We [Yemenis] and all of our Ummah's Mujahideen are not afraid of America's threats or its hell and are not content with its approval or paradise." 

The recent joint operations carried out by the Yemeni Armed Forces and the Iraqi Islamic Resistance, which targeted deep into the occupied territories, were praised, with the statement further calling on the Arab and Islamic nations to "be wary of America’s machinations aimed at dismantling the Ummah and plunging Muslims into conflicts and secondary problems," and to carry out "its religious responsibility and duties." morality and humanity toward what is happening in Gaza."

The statement denounced "the shameful positions of some Arab and Islamic regimes, which have made themselves a crossing bridge and a supply for the enemy at a time when the people of Gaza are starving."

This comes after the leader of the Yemeni Ansar Allah movement, Sayyed Abdul-Malik al-Houthi, highlighted that the United States and the Israeli occupation "are attempting to completely divert attention from the Palestinian issue, aiming to liquidate it in an environment of complete distraction, while simultaneously opening fronts against anyone who stands in solidarity with it."
